1. ホーム
  2. android

[解決済み] adbを使用すると、dataフォルダへのアクセスが拒否されるのはなぜですか?

2022-02-09 20:14:40

質問

adbを使い、以下のコマンドでライブ端末に接続しました。

C:\>adb -s HT829GZ52000 shell
$ ls
ls
sqlite_stmt_journals
cache
sdcard
etc
system
sys
sbin
proc
logo.rle
init.trout.rc
init.rc
init.goldfish.rc
init
default.prop
data
root
dev
$ cd data
cd data
$ ls
ls
opendir failed, Permission denied

アクセス拒否されていることに驚きました。どうしてこのようにコマンドラインを使ってディレクトリをブラウズすることができないのでしょうか?

携帯電話のルートアクセスを取得するにはどうすればよいですか?

解決するには?

デバイスのすべてを閲覧したい場合、2つのことを覚えておく必要があります。

  1. Android端末でデータフォルダを閲覧するには、root権限がある端末である必要があります。つまり、開発者用デバイス ( ADP1 または イオン または、他の方法で携帯電話を「ルート化」する方法を見つけた場合。
  2. ADBをrootモードで実行する必要があるので、これを実行します。 adb root